In her autobiography The Woman in Me, Britney Spears describes her ex-boyfriend Justin Timberlake as a horrible character. According to her, the singer, aged 19 at the time, forced her to have an abortion before leaving her by SMS. These revelations did not fail to arouse the anger of fans towards the interpreter of Cry Me a River.
On social networks, certain accounts make fun of the American’s songs. “We reap what we sow and this time it’s your turn Justin,” reports a user on an Instagram post by the singer, in reference to the song What Goes Around Comes Back Around. we sow). The title Cry Me A River is also mocked by Britney Spears fans: “It’s you who now has to cry a river.” Some comments, however, are more vindictive. “You are the worst singer in the world”, “I hope Britney gets her revenge”, “you should be ashamed of having ruined her life”, “don’t listen to her music anymore”, reacted the singer’s fans .

On the social network X (formerly Twitter), opinions are more divided. If some fans overwhelm Justin Timberlake and call him a “monster”, others take his side. “Why go after Justin Timberlake? For admitting that neither of them were ready to have a baby? You are all weird, leave this man alone,” says one user. “I don’t care about these stories, I will continue to listen to his music,” posts another account. Other users also analyzed Britney Spears’ songs from the era, looking for hidden messages about their past relationship. According to fans, the pop star’s song Everytime is addressed to the baby she didn’t have. “I think I need you baby / And every time I see you in my dreams / I see your face, it haunts me”, sings the American in particular.
